This campground/park has no on-site shower facilities.
- Under 18s must be accompanied by their parents or legal guardians.
- Your dog must be tattooed or microchipped.
- Dogs are not allowed if you are staying in the accommodation units.
- No cars/motorbikes by the pitch/unit. All cars must be parked in the designated area.
- At least one of the party members must be aged 21 or over.
- Guests are advised to bring a good quality torch with them as parts of the campground/park are unlit.
- If reception is closed on arrival: please contact the number provided on your booking confirmation.
- There is access to a toilet in the main park, please note this is a 10-minute walk from the campsite.

Liked Highly recommend for families! First time visiting Auchingarrich - couldn’t believe the variety of animals. Amazing views from the park and the campsite. Loved seeing some of the animals roaming freely, we had the white peacock and the owners dog sat with us for ages at our tent 😄 Also great being able to wander around the park after hours - we were out until after 11pm with our 3 year old and had the best time. Such a beautiful location, all staff SO friendly and approachable and soooo much to do and see. Brilliant value for money, well stocked gift shop and everything clean and tidy. Compost toilet was clean but you can access proper toilets at any time too in the main building. Map and info pack provided on arrival. We would definitely come back and have recommended to friends and family.

Liked The peace, the quiet, the cleanliness and the sheer magnitude of outdoor space! The animals are lovely, friendly and exceptionally well cared for - the variety of animals on the site was mind blowing. The views alone are breathtaking.
The staff are incredibly helpful, friendly and polite - every single member we interacted with had a smile on their faces...including the young lad who was still working helping other guests well into the evening.
The gift shop is well stocked and includes those essentials that are often forgotten during a camping trip!
We're recommending this site to all of our family and friends, and will be visiting again at the earliest opportunity.
